Output e055682d4fb94131d9e8e8df29b78f56b5e8eec44d6a102dffdd76b4a33f736a:1

value
1393907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1bd54be385e071a412a54e7883eea9d1eaba51 OP_EQUAL
address
34XWDNfh5XXdj7H4TH7sD6ZQRPRTy4U633
transaction
e055682d4fb94131d9e8e8df29b78f56b5e8eec44d6a102dffdd76b4a33f736a
confirmations
347670
spent
true